Use below code to get data from GTFS....Copy the code in a blank query and replace https://developers.....with your link

let
    Source = Web.Contents("https://developers.google.com/transit/gtfs/examples/sample-feed.zip"),
    //Function Start - Credit - https://sql10.blogspot.com/2016/06/reading-zip-files-in-powerquery-m.html
    UnzipContents=(ZIPFile) =>
    let
        Header = BinaryFormat.Record([
            MiscHeader = BinaryFormat.Binary(14),
            BinarySize = BinaryFormat.ByteOrder(BinaryFormat.UnsignedInteger32, ByteOrder.LittleEndian),
            FileSize   = BinaryFormat.ByteOrder(BinaryFormat.UnsignedInteger32, ByteOrder.LittleEndian),
            FileNameLen= BinaryFormat.ByteOrder(BinaryFormat.UnsignedInteger16, ByteOrder.LittleEndian),
            ExtrasLen  = BinaryFormat.ByteOrder(BinaryFormat.UnsignedInteger16, ByteOrder.LittleEndian)    
        ]),
        HeaderChoice = BinaryFormat.Choice(
            BinaryFormat.ByteOrder(BinaryFormat.UnsignedInteger32, ByteOrder.LittleEndian),
            each if _ <> 67324752             // not the IsValid number? then return a dummy formatter
                then BinaryFormat.Record([IsValid = false, Filename=null, Content=null])
                else BinaryFormat.Choice(
                        BinaryFormat.Binary(26),      // Header payload - 14+4+4+2+2
                        each BinaryFormat.Record([
                            IsValid  = true,
                            Filename = BinaryFormat.Text(Header(_)[FileNameLen]),
                            Extras   = BinaryFormat.Text(Header(_)[ExtrasLen]),
                            Content  = BinaryFormat.Transform(
                                BinaryFormat.Binary(Header(_)[BinarySize]),
                                (x) => try Binary.Buffer(Binary.Decompress(x, Compression.Deflate)) otherwise null
                            )
                            ]),
                            type binary                   // enable streaming
                    )
        ),
        ZipFormat = BinaryFormat.List(HeaderChoice, each _[IsValid] = true),
        Entries = List.Transform(
        List.RemoveLastN( ZipFormat(ZIPFile), 1),
        (e) => [FileName = e[Filename], Content = e[Content] ]
        )
    in
        Table.FromRecords(Entries),
        //Function End
    Files = UnzipContents(Source)
in
    Files
